You wouldn't have pushed a head gasket for that little of change in temp. :)
Frankly if you pushed a head gasket EVERY even with like 25psi of boost.
You would have to be doing something majorly wrong. LOL.

I have pushed ONE headgasket on a mod-motor...
42psi of boost, stock block, stock heads.
Had an injector clog, and well.... knock knock. :)

We aren't allowed to make the fan come on 100% like that.
Due to not wanting to burn the fan up, and emissions reasons.
Not saying it WILL burn out (GMs used to when that was done)
Just saying after the GM's started doing it, we weren't allowed to touch the factory settings.
